Police chief tells men to stop eating pawikan

/ 09:00 AM March 13, 2013

A FEW days after he admitted indulging in pawikan stew in barangay Pasil, Senior Supt. Mariano Natu-el, Jr., acting chief of the Cebu City Police Office ordered his mean not to patronize the exotic dish.

But before Natu-el’s announcement, some policemen were seen eating “larang pawikan” in Pasil.

Natu-el said the pawikan (sea turtle) issue should first be resolved by Department of Environment and Natural Resources (DENR) which is mandated by law to protect the endangered marine reptiles.

Senior Inspector Eunil Avergonzado yesterday told reporters that they are waiting for DENR to coordinate with them to conduct an operation.

Under Republic Act 9147 or the Wildlife Conservation and Protection Act, anyone who is involved in the selling and trade of pawikan meat shall be imprisoned for two years and is mandated to pay a fine of up to P200,000. The same penalty applies for anyone who eats the meat of the endangered species. A stiffer penalty of four to six years of imprisonment as well as a fine of P500,000 await the person who slaughter pawikan.

“Everybody involved will be liable. This is a penal law. Slaughtering our pawikans is basically the same with killing a human being,” said environment lawyer Benjamin Cabrido. (See related story on page 2)

He said they cannot operate by their own without clearance or authority from te DENR.

Chief Inspector Romeo Santander, chief of City Intelligence Branch (CIB) said thathis men are ready to assist the DENR anytime./Correspondent Chito O. Aragon
